The Square lies within an area bound by Lisle Street, to the north; Charing Cross Road, to the east; Orange Street, to the south; and Whitcomb Street, to the west. The park at the centre of the Square is bound by Cranbourn Street, to the north; Leicester Street, to the east; Irving Street, to the south; and a section of road designated simply as Leicester Square, to the west. It is within the City of Westminster, and about equal distances (about 400 yards or 370 metres) north of Trafalgar Square, east of Piccadilly Circus, west of Covent Garden, and south of Cambridge Circus. • This smallish London square is the site of most British film premieres and the square itself is surrounded by terrifyingly-expensive cinemas - tickets for an evening screening will cost upwards of £17, 3D screenings will cost upwards of £15. At night, Leicester Square becomes exceptionally busy with tourists and locals, visiting the surrounding clubs and bars. In the north-west corner of the square is the Swiss Centre - unaccountably popular with tourists, the building is nowadays home to Sound nightclub, and boasts a carillion in the corner which depicts a Swiss mountain scene and plays tinny versions of Beatles hits on the hour throughout the day. The TKTS half price ticket booth is on the south side of Leicester Square for cheap tickets for theatre performances.
